The company are seeking a skilled and experienced Panel Beater (/Paint Sprayer) to join their busy workshop team.
- Utilise a range of metalworking techniques, including dent pulling, shaping, planishing, and filling.
- Perform welding, bonding, and riveting as required, adhering to safety and quality standards.
- Dismantle and reassemble mechanical and electrical trim (MET) components as needed for repairs.
Proven experience as a Panel Beater or Vehicle Body Repairer in an accident repair environment.
Proficiency in using a variety of hand tools, power tools, and welding equipment.
Strong technical skills with an excellent eye for detail and a commitment to quality workmanship.
Relevant technical qualifications such as NVQ Level 2 or 3 in Vehicle Body and Paint Operations, or equivalent.
ATA (Automotive Technician Accreditation) in Panel preferred but not essential.
A full UK driving licence.
